just had one of my confirmation e-mails bounced with the following message -
SMTP error from remote mailer after initial connection:
host mx2.mail.yahoo.com [64.156.215.5]: 553 Mail from 212.67.202.237 not allowed - VS99-IP1 deferred - see help.yahoo.com/help/us/mail/defer/defer-02.html (#5.7.1)
this is a new one on me, anyone else seen it? I tried again manully and got the same message. The yahoo page says it thinks it is spam for some reason. My ISP is clara.

If your ISP allocates IP addresses randomly it is possible that the IP address allocated to you for that send used to belong to a spammer and so is banned. This happened to a customer of mine at the weekend.
